Danielle Smith said the program infringes on provincial jurisdiction

Alberta Premier Danielle Smith says the province plans to opt out of the federal government’s dental care plan by 2026.

“Alberta has long maintained that it would be more effective to expand existing provincial programs than to introduce a new federal plan,” Smith wrote in the letter, saying that about 500,000 Albertans already benefit from provincial coverage. Alberta Health Minister Adriana LaGrange’s office said in a statement the Canadian Dental Care Plan duplicates coverage provided by Alberta’s low-income dental programs.

“To Premier Smith, we ask her to put politics aside so she can work with us to expand dental care coverage in Alberta.”The Canadian Dental Association has been sparring with the federal government over the details of the plan, saying confusion over what is covered and who qualifies has added extra pressure at dental offices and undermines patient care.
